ir5 <br /> 411 . <br /> • <br /> • <br /> ..... • „ <br /> • <br /> • Department Report <br /> Housing and Community Development <br /> • • <br /> The mission of the Housing and Community Development Department is • <br /> to, revitalize deteriorating communities, provide rental assistance <br /> opportunities for low-income families by utilizing existing housing units, <br /> and investigate minimum housing code complaints. <br /> The department has two separate but related divisions. The housing <br /> component of the department administers the Rental Subsidy Programs which <br /> consist of Section 8 Existing and Section 8 Moderate Rehabilitation. - . <br /> Community Development activities and Minimum Housing Code Enforcement are • <br /> administered by the Community Development Division. <br /> There are obvious County-wide conditions which bring about the need <br /> for services rendered by this department. They are: <br /> (A) Shortage of Low and Moderate Income Rental Housing <br /> Currently, Housing and Community Development has a <br /> Section 8 Existing Housing Waiting List which totals <br /> 500 families. With increasing rental housing cost <br /> prevelant, the need for affordable, decent, safe and <br /> • <br /> sanitary rental housing has become a pressing demand. <br /> The Section 8 Programs serve as a remedy for those <br /> demands. <br /> (8) Deteriorating Communities <br /> Along with rental housing needs, there are deteriorating <br /> communities within the County that exhibit the following <br /> Characteristics: substandard housing; inadequate public <br /> facilities (roads, water and sewer); the lack of home <br /> • . <br /> ownership Opportunities because of poor public facilities; <br /> and blighting conditions that present potential health <br /> and safety hazards to community residents. Community <br /> Development activities are designed to alleviate these <br /> poor conditions. <br /> (C) Substandard Rental Housing <br /> • In many instances, substandard rental housing is the <br /> product of increasing housing cost. Generally tenants <br /> occupy substandard units because it is last resort <br /> housing. Minimum Housing Code Enforcement offers the <br /> tenant a means to file housing code complaints and <br /> ensures that complaints will be formally investigated. <br /> Program efficiency is the overall goal for the Section 8 component. <br /> That goal has been accomplished in 1984-85 by achieving the following <br /> • objectives: (1) a thorough assessment of all elements within the program <br /> operation; (2) modification and refinement of all operational systems; <br /> (3) implementation of new policies, guidelines and procedures. Community <br /> Development objectives are: the rehabilitation of substandard dwellings; <br /> the improvement of public facilities; acquisition of real property, and <br /> clearance of blighting influences '(dilapidated structures and unsafe ' • <br /> debris). Not only are these program objectives ongoing throughout the <br /> year 'but the objectives are also mandates established by the North <br /> Carolina Department of Natural Resources and Community Development (NRCD). <br /> • <br />
